Our first tenant drop-in of 2026 was at Cedarwood, North Shields, on Wednesday 18 February. We were delighted that 19 tenants came along for advice. Questions were on a wide range of subjects, including Homefinder, gardens, damp and mould, repairs and finance.

Nine tenant drop-ins were held during 2025, at venues in Longbenton, Meadow Well, Howdon, Battle Hill, Dudley, Shiremoor, Wallsend and Killingworth. A total of 124 tenants got advice and had their questions answered, and feedback from those who came along was very positive.
